what is cullens sign?
oedema and bruising around umbilicus
indicates severe acute pancreatitis
what is grey turner’s sign?
bruising of flank areas
indicates pancreatic problem
what is erythema ab igne?
“hot water bottle rash”
due to excess exposure to heat

how is diverticulitis classified?
Hinchey classification
1 = paracolic abscess 2 = pelvic abscess 3 = purulent peritonitis 4 = faecal peritonitis
what is hartmann’s procedure?
removes sigmoid colon
leaves rectum
creates colostomy
used in diverticulitis
